Understanding the Factors that Affect Mobile App Development Cost

The cost of mobile app development is influenced by several factors, including the type of app, platform, technology stack, design complexity, and development team. For instance, a simple app with a basic design and limited features can cost between $10,000 to $50,000, while a complex app with advanced features and a custom design can cost upwards of $100,000 to $500,000. Estimating the Cost of Mobile App Development

To estimate the cost of mobile app development, businesses need to consider the following factors: app type, platform, technology stack, design complexity, and development team. For example, developing a mobile app for both iOS and Android platforms can increase the cost by 20-30% compared to developing for a single platform. Additionally, using a cross-platform framework such as React Native or Flutter can reduce the cost by 10-20% compared to native development. Breaking Down the Cost of Mobile App Development

The cost of mobile app development can be broken down into several components, including design, development, testing, and deployment. The design component can account for 10-20% of the total cost, while the development component can account for 60-80%. The testing and deployment components can account for 10-20% of the total cost.
